<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>https://dev.vanipedia.org/w/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AJquery.getParams.js</id>
	<title>MediaWiki:Jquery.getParams.js - Revision history</title>
	<link rel="self" type="application/atom+xml" href="https://dev.vanipedia.org/w/index.php?action=history&amp;feed=atom&amp;title=MediaWiki%3AJquery.getParams.js"/>
	<link rel="alternate" type="text/html" href="https://dev.vanipedia.org/w/index.php?title=MediaWiki:Jquery.getParams.js&amp;action=history"/>
	<updated>2026-06-12T09:08:23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.45.3</generator>
	<entry>
		<id>https://dev.vanipedia.org/w/index.php?title=MediaWiki:Jquery.getParams.js&amp;diff=857&amp;oldid=prev</id>
		<title>Acyuta: New page: /* Copyright (c) 2006 Mathias Bank (http://www.mathias-bank.de)  * Dual licensed under the MIT (http://www.opensource.org/licenses/mit-license.php)   * and GPL (http://www.opensource.org/l...</title>
		<link rel="alternate" type="text/html" href="https://dev.vanipedia.org/w/index.php?title=MediaWiki:Jquery.getParams.js&amp;diff=857&amp;oldid=prev"/>
		<updated>2008-07-11T09:32:47Z</updated>

		<summary type="html">&lt;p&gt;New page: /* Copyright (c) 2006 Mathias Bank (http://www.mathias-bank.de)  * Dual licensed under the MIT (http://www.opensource.org/licenses/mit-license.php)   * and GPL (http://www.opensource.org/l...&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;/* Copyright (c) 2006 Mathias Bank (http://www.mathias-bank.de)&lt;br /&gt;
 * Dual licensed under the MIT (http://www.opensource.org/licenses/mit-license.php) &lt;br /&gt;
 * and GPL (http://www.opensource.org/licenses/gpl-license.php) licenses.&lt;br /&gt;
 * &lt;br /&gt;
 * Thanks to Hinnerk Ruemenapf - http://hinnerk.ruemenapf.de/ for bug reporting and fixing.&lt;br /&gt;
 */&lt;br /&gt;
jQuery.extend({&lt;br /&gt;
/**&lt;br /&gt;
* Returns get parameters.&lt;br /&gt;
*&lt;br /&gt;
* If the desired param does not exist, null will be returned&lt;br /&gt;
*&lt;br /&gt;
* @example value = $.getURLParam(&amp;quot;paramName&amp;quot;);&lt;br /&gt;
*/ &lt;br /&gt;
 getURLParam: function(strParamName){&lt;br /&gt;
	  var strReturn = &amp;quot;&amp;quot;;&lt;br /&gt;
	  var strHref = window.location.href;&lt;br /&gt;
	  var bFound=false;&lt;br /&gt;
	  &lt;br /&gt;
	  var cmpstring = strParamName + &amp;quot;=&amp;quot;;&lt;br /&gt;
	  var cmplen = cmpstring.length;&lt;br /&gt;
&lt;br /&gt;
	  if ( strHref.indexOf(&amp;quot;?&amp;quot;) &amp;gt; -1 ){&lt;br /&gt;
	    var strQueryString = strHref.substr(strHref.indexOf(&amp;quot;?&amp;quot;)+1);&lt;br /&gt;
	    var aQueryString = strQueryString.split(&amp;quot;&amp;amp;&amp;quot;);&lt;br /&gt;
	    for ( var iParam = 0; iParam &amp;lt; aQueryString.length; iParam++ ){&lt;br /&gt;
	      if (aQueryString[iParam].substr(0,cmplen)==cmpstring){&lt;br /&gt;
	        var aParam = aQueryString[iParam].split(&amp;quot;=&amp;quot;);&lt;br /&gt;
	        strReturn = aParam[1];&lt;br /&gt;
	        bFound=true;&lt;br /&gt;
	        break;&lt;br /&gt;
	      }&lt;br /&gt;
	      &lt;br /&gt;
	    }&lt;br /&gt;
	  }&lt;br /&gt;
	  if (bFound==false) return null;&lt;br /&gt;
	  return strReturn;&lt;br /&gt;
	}&lt;br /&gt;
});&lt;/div&gt;</summary>
		<author><name>Acyuta</name></author>
	</entry>
</feed>